Transaction dff63cec255090cfd6fe85db2afc352096030118c18d97e762ad51711e92d439
1 Input
1 Output
-
dff63cec255090cfd6fe85db2afc352096030118c18d97e762ad51711e92d439:0
- value
- 251430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dce6e4bfb7b07773c167380f10ae4f1f6e22d689 OP_EQUAL
- address
- 3Mq3BWdC4dCbKvyN5ZCgnqXcwFXvrjopE7